The Boeing CompanyThe Boeing Company is seeking a Software Process Engineer (Experienced/Senior) in El Segundo, CA that is passionate about space and excited to work in a multi-disciplined, collaborative engineering environment that supports the design, development, and implementation of software for a new fleet of Boeing satellites. This position will focus on supporting the Boeing Defense, Space & Security (BDS) Space Mission Systems Software Engineering organization.
The selected candidate will lead software process implementation/governance for a large-scale satellite development program, for all phases of the software development lifecycle. The position will lead process instantiation into engineering artifacts and documentation for satellite system software teams developing embedded/real-time satellite flight software, satellite simulation software, satellite databases, cybersecurity software, satellite ground-control software, and software development environments (DevSecOps).
Position Responsibilities:
Leading the incorporation of Boeing Enterprise Software Design Practices (DPs) and process assets into the full lifecycle of engineering artifacts/byproducts (review artifacts, code analysis output, etc.) and documentation (e.g. software development plans, specifications, test plans, etc.)
Leading the formal development & approval of these artifacts for use by software teams and for delivery to the customer(s)
Guiding usage/adoption of these artifacts by software teams to ensure adherence
Supporting process compliance reviews and audits, product peer reviews, Technical Design Reviews, gate reviews, and customer reviews
Advising software engineering management and program leadership on software process adherence and implementation strategies to ensure engineering excellence and program success
Designing/implementing process and tooling that generates and collects software metrics required by the measurement/metrics plan; guiding software metrics planning, generation, collection, analysis, and dissemination
Leading software process training to educate software teams about new & emerging software processes
Leading review of products and processes for alignment with project plans and applicable Boeing (Enterprise/BDS/El Segundo)/industry standards
